news 2026/5/8 15:54:45

实话很难听,但这就是26年前端面试现状……

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
实话很难听,但这就是26年前端面试现状……

1️⃣ 按照目前行业趋势,前端能力模型正从页面实现转向价值量化,2025年的岗位要求将是技术架构+性能体验+业务价值三合一;我们团队即便联合产品和设计反复打磨,也才勉强摸到工程化体系的门槛,代价是连续半年为性能优化和稳定性保障996救火。


2️⃣ 实际开发流程中,单靠UI稿还原早已被淘汰,2025的主流协作模式是设计系统+性能监控平台+灰度发布流水线,头部大厂的业务线基本按这个节奏跑。


3️⃣ 招聘场面看似火爆,实际每天筛上百份简历都难匹配工程思维与业务sense;团队大部分精力消耗在技术债务偿还和产品需求反复上,前端岗内卷到连低代码平台搭建都变成硬指标,我们组给的40k薪资在2025年可能连中级岗都抢不到。


4️⃣ 专业能力架构上,框架熟练度快成基础项了,下一代前端可能需要懂跨端框架深度定制和工程效能体系建设;技术方案决策也变了,不再是团队内部分享,而是结合线上性能数据和业务指标归因做选型,有时一次科学的压测数据比十次技术争论更有效。


5️⃣ 技术评审翻车已成常态,同一个产品需求这周要轻量化下周却追加复杂交互;我们经常遭遇上午定技术方案下午推翻的剧情,唯一能做的就是用设计系统和工具链强约束,靠自动化测试和监控告警保持项目进度。


6️⃣ 技术价值论证不再是罗列项目清单,2025年的复盘必须展示性能提升对业务指标的影响和工程效能提升数据;能力边界也在扩张,从写业务代码进化到搭建监控系统、设计CI/CD流水线,不过线上故障现在变成一票否决项,没通过性能和安全评审的需求直接熔断。

记住:3-5年的前端开发者,应该展现出能够独立负责复杂模块、主导技术方案、赋能团队成长的能力。这不仅仅是技术的深度,更是思考的维度和解决问题的系统方法。

以下:DDD

1.请求失败会弹出一个toast,如何保证批量请求失败,只弹出一个toast

2.如何减少项目里面 if-else

3.babel-runtime 作用是啥

4.如何实现预览PDF文件

5.如何在划词选择的文本上添加右键菜单(划词:鼠标滑动选择一组字符,对组字符进行操作)

6.富文本里面,是如何做到划词的(鼠标滑动选择一组字符,对组字符进行操作)?

7.如何做好前端监控方案

8.如何标准化处理线上用户反馈的问题

9.px 如何转为 rem

10.浏览器有同源策略,但是为何cdn请求资源的时候不会有跨域限制

11.cookie可以实现不同域共享吗

12.axios是否可以取消请求

13.前端如何实现折叠面板效果?

14.dom里面,如何判定a元素是否是b元素的子元

15.判断一个对象是否为空,包含了其原型链上是否有自定义数据或者方法。该如何判定?

.................................................................................................................................

20.如何清理源码里面没有被应用的代码,主要是JS、TS、CSS代码

21.前端应用如何做国际化?

22.应用如何做应用灰度发布

23.[微前端]为何通常在微前端应用隔离,不选择iframe方案

24.[微前端]Qiankun是如何做JS 隔离的

25.[微前端]微前端架构一般是如何做JavaScript隔离

26.[React]循环渲染中为什么推荐不用index 做 key

27.[React]如何避免使用context的时候,引起整个挂载节点树的重新渲染

28.前端如何实现截图?

29.当QPS达到峰值时,该如何处理?

30.js超过Number 最大值的数怎么处理?

31.使用同一个链接,如何实现PC打开是web应用、手机打开是一个H5 应用?

32.如何保证用户的使用体验

33.如何解决页面请求接口大规模并发问题

34.设计一套全站请求耗时统计工具

35.大文件上传了解多少

...................................................................................................................................

45.什么是领域模型

46.一直在window上面挂东西是否有什么风险

47.深度SEO优化的方式有哪些,从技术层面来说

48.小程序为什么会有两个线程

49.web应用中如何对静态资源加载失败的场景做降级处理

50.html中前缀为data-开头的元素属性是什么?

51.移动端如何实现上拉加载,下拉刷新?

52.如何判断dom元素是否在可视区域

53.前端如何用canvas来做电影院选票功能

54.如何通过设置失效时间清除本地存储的数据?

55.如果不使用脚手架,如果用webpack构建一个自己的react应用

56.用nodejs实现一个命令行工具,统计输入目录下面指定代码的行数

57.packagejson里面 sideEffects 属性的作用是啥

58.script标签上有那些属性,分别作用是啥?

59.为什么SPA应用都会提供一个hash路由,好处是什么?

60.[React]如何进行路由变化监听

.................................................................................................................................................

70.虚拟滚动加载原理是什么,用JS代码简单实现一个虚拟滚动加载。

71.[React]react-router和原生路由区别

72.html的行内元素和块级元素的区别

73.介绍-下requestldleCallback api

74.documentFragment api是什么,有哪些使用场景?

75.git pull 和 git fetch 有啥区别?

76.前端如何做页面主题色切换

77.前端视角-如何保证系统稳定性

78.如何统计长任务时间,长任务执行次数

79.V8 里面的JIT是什么?

80.用JS写一个cookies解析函数,输出结果为一个对象

81.vue 中 Scoped Styles是如何实现样式隔离的,原理是啥?

82.样式隔离方式有哪些

83.在JS中,如何解决递归导致栈溢出问题?

84.站点如何防止爬虫?

85.ts项目中,如何使用node_modules里面定义的全局类型包到自己项目src下面使用?

86.不同标签页或窗口间的【主动推送消息机制】的方式有哪(不借助服务端)?

..................................................................................................................................................

90.[webpack]打包时 hash码是如何生成的

91.如何从0到1搭建前端基建

92.你在开发过程中,使用过哪些TS的特性或者能力?

93.JS的加载会阻塞浏览器渲染吗?

94.浏览器对队头阻塞有什么优化?

95.Webpack项目中通过script 标签引I入资源,在项目中如何处理?

96.应用上线后,怎么通知用户刷新当前页面?

97.Eslint代码检查的过程是啥?

98.HTTP是一个无状态的协议,那么Web应用要怎么保持用户的登录态呢?

99.如何检测网页空闲状态(一定时间内无操作)

100.为什么Vite速度比Webpack 快?

101.列表分页,快速翻页下的竞态问题

102.JS执行100万个任务,如何保证浏览器不卡顿?

103.git仓库迁移应该怎么操作

104.如何禁止别人调试自己的前端页面代码?

105.web系统里面,如何对图片进行优化?

106.OAuth2.0是什么登录方式

107.单点登录是如何实现的?

....................................................................................................................................................

记住:面试的本质,从来不是考察你会背什么,而是证明你能解决什么。

接下来的内容,将基于最新面试实况,为你揭示如何在新时代的前端面试中展现真正的工程实力。我们将一起探索如何将技术深度转化为解决方案,将项目经验转化为价值证明。

现在,让我们一起把握这个更加务实、也更具挑战的web前端面试新纪元。

以上:DDD

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/6 16:55:10

# Flutter Provider 状态管理完全指南

一、Provider 概述Provider 是 Flutter 官方推荐的状态管理库,它基于 InheritedWidget 实现,通过依赖注入的方式在 Widget 树中高效地共享和管理状态。Provider 的核心优势在于其简单性和高效性——它只在状态变更时重建依赖该状态的 Widget,…

作者头像 李华
网站建设 2026/4/30 14:45:24

零代码玩转AI分类:这些云端工具让你事半功倍

零代码玩转AI分类:这些云端工具让你事半功倍 引言:当业务需求遇上技术排期 作为业务主管,你是否遇到过这样的困境:市场调研收集了上千份问卷,急需分析用户反馈,但IT部门排期已经排到三个月后?…

作者头像 李华
网站建设 2026/5/3 11:07:54

分类模型效果提升50%:万能分类器调参+云端GPU实测

分类模型效果提升50%:万能分类器调参云端GPU实测 引言 作为一名算法工程师,你是否经历过这样的痛苦:为了优化分类模型参数,每次实验都要在本地机器上跑2小时,一天最多只能尝试5-6组参数组合?而当你终于找…

作者头像 李华
网站建设 2026/5/2 19:10:23

MiDaS模型优化教程:提升CPU推理速度的5个技巧

MiDaS模型优化教程:提升CPU推理速度的5个技巧 1. 引言:AI 单目深度估计 - MiDaS 在计算机视觉领域,单目深度估计(Monocular Depth Estimation)是一项极具挑战但又极具应用价值的技术。它允许AI仅通过一张2D图像推断出…

作者头像 李华
网站建设 2026/4/29 13:40:52

关系数据库-05. 关系的完整性-用户定义的完整性

3.3.3 用户定义的完整性 针对某一具体关系数据库的约束条件,反映某一具体应用所涉及的数据必须满足的语义要求。关系模型应提供定义和检验这类完整性的机制,以便用统一的系统的方法处理它们,而不需由应用程序承担这一功能。 例: 课程&#…

作者头像 李华
网站建设 2026/5/4 5:20:09

支持REST API的中文NER服务|AI智能实体侦测镜像推荐

支持REST API的中文NER服务|AI智能实体侦测镜像推荐 1. 背景与需求:从非结构化文本中提取关键信息 在当今信息爆炸的时代,企业、媒体和科研机构每天都在处理海量的非结构化文本数据——新闻报道、社交媒体评论、客户反馈、法律文书等。这些…

作者头像 李华